This series always makes me smile. The queer teacher group chat is of course always a highlight. Amos, Everett, Julian, and Chase are such a great group of friends and even though they give each other a hard time, you know it comes from a place of love. Even when they inadvertently upset Julian, they all made sure to apologize and make it right. Each of them always cheers for the other's accomplishments. They also are always there if someone needs a pick me up. Like I said, great group of friends.

Know who else is also a good friend? Seamus. I mean what other straight guy would offer to be a partner for Julian to explore sex for the first time? *insert eye roll here* Yes, I know exactly what you're thinking. Straight my ass, or should I say Seamus' ass? Either way kudos to Julian because not only is Seamus a good friend, but he also has a good heart. It's just that Seamus is the only one who doesn't see it.


"Was I so drunk that I imagined Seamus offering to deflower me?

'That's what friends are for. '

Friends were for giving you a ride when your car broke down, not for letting you ride them."



*snort laugh* Yup. Good ol friendly Seamus. I really loved how he boosted up Julian's confidence. Not being Mr. perfect abs and constantly getting ragged on for his weight has left Julian with pitifully low self-esteem. I wanted to cheer when he finally started gaining some confidence in himself. It also wasn't all one sided. Seamus has a past which has been a total burden on his present. Not only did Julian not judge him for this, but he also made sure that Seamus understood that his past didn't define his whole life. It was a real give and take, exactly what a healthy relationship should be.

Truman hit a home run with this one

I am no stranger to Truman’s work - honestly, their books are some of my favourites in the MM world. But this one just has something truly special about it - it feels very personal.

Seamus and Julian are a beautiful pairing - their backstories are beautiful, truly emotive and very carefully written - I found myself on the verge of tears at several points. I honestly don’t think this one can be topped, but we will see once Chase’s story comes out!

I loved this book - the genuine friendship that these men have before embarking on their arrangement is wonderful and I love that Seamus is open and willing to try new things as he embarks on his bi-awakening... and helps Julian to find his own true voice and accept himself as worthy...

This book gives us lots of feels, lots of friends and a particularly feisty grandmother whom I adore! It's well paced and my only complaint is that I wish Julian's mother had more of a reckoning, but I'm glad she is seeing the error of her ways...
